Description

Offered with NO ONWARD CHAIN is this well-presented two-bedroom end-terrace property located in the sought-after village of Rode Heath. The property has previously had planning permission granted for a two-storey extension, offering excellent potential for further development (subject to any necessary  planning consents).

In brief, the accommodation comprises an entrance hallway, modern fitted kitchen, and a spacious lounge with dining area. To the first floor are two well-proportioned double bedrooms and a contemporary family bathroom.

Externally, the property benefits from ample off-road parking and a generous rear garden featuring a useful wooden outbuilding. Further benefits include double glazing and central heating throughout.

An ideal purchase for first-time buyers or those looking to extend and add value.

Here are the top 7 things you need to know when moving home:

Get your house valued by 3 different agents before you put it on the market

Don't pick the agent that values it the highest, without evidence of other properties sold in the same area

It's always best to put your house on the market before you find a property

The estate agent acts for the seller and is there to get the seller the best price possible

Understand the length of time it can take - 14 weeks from when you accept an offer, or have an offer accepted to move in! A long time!

It can get stressful, but speak to your agent and your solicitor and they will put you in the picture
